LATE CABLES.
By, Telegraph—Press AssociationCopy right.Received 1.15 a.m., March 24. Christiana, March 23. Fiola, leader of Ziegler’s Arctic expedition, is preparing to start from Troinsoe in June. He will take two years’ provisions.
Rome, March 23.
An Italian engineer claims that he has discovered a rneaus of telegraphing and telephoning simultaneously ou the same wire. Signor Galimlierti, PostmasterGeneral, is arranging experiments. Loudon, March 23.
The Daily .Mail says that the weakness of New South Wales issues is duo to tho fear that Government is meeting interost on loans out of the recent issue of bills. The main column from Abfia bus arrived at Galkayu. It sufferod severely owing to exhausting heat, especially tho Sikhs and Bombay sappers. The column, reinforced by 750 camels, is pushing on to Galadi, whither tho Mullah is reported to have fled. Received 1.30 a.m., March 24.
Sydney, Mar. 23. The thermometer reached 94 to-day. It is probable that if details can be settled Warner will pilot the next Englieh team to Australia.
Sailed : The Sierra, for Sau Francisco via Auckland.
